====== Phenformin 20μM R05 exp212 ======
==== Mechanism of Action ====
Inhibits mitochondrial respiratory chain complex I, indirectly activates AMPK
* **Class / Subclass 1:** Organelle Function / Mitochondrial Inhibitor
* **Class / Subclass 2:** Metabolism / Metabolic Enzyme Activator
==== Technical Notes ====
* **PubChem Name:** %%Phenformin hydrochloride%%
* **Synonyms:** Phenethylbiguanide hydrochloride
* **CAS #:** 834-28-6
* **PubChem CID:** [[https://pubchem.ncbi.nlm.nih.gov/compound/13266|13266]]
* **IUPAC:** %%1-(diaminomethylidene)-2-(2-phenylethyl)guanidine;hydrochloride%%
* **INCHI Name:** InChI=1S/C10H15N5.ClH/c11-9(12)15-10(13)14-7-6-8-4-2-1-3-5-8;/h1-5H,6-7H2,(H6,11,12,13,14,15);1H
* **INCHI Key:** YSUCWSWKRIOILX-UHFFFAOYSA-N
* **Molecular Weight:** 241.72
* **Canonical SMILES:** C1=CC=C(C=C1)CCN=C(N)N=C(N)N.Cl
* **Isomeric SMILES:** N/A
* **Molecular Formula:** C10H16ClN5
